Detailsinfo

A vulnerability was found in Linux Kernel up to 4.19.249/5.4.201/5.10.126/5.15.50/5.18.7. It has been rated as critical. Affected by this issue is the function of_find_matching_node. The manipulation with an unknown input leads to a reference count vulnerability. Using CWE to declare the problem leads to CWE-911. The product uses a reference count to manage a resource, but it does not update or incorrectly updates the reference count. Impacted is availability. CVE summarizes:

In the Linux kernel, the following vulnerability has been resolved: soc: bcm: brcmstb: pm: pm-arm: Fix refcount leak in brcmstb_pm_probe of_find_matching_node() returns a node pointer with refcount incremented, we should use of_node_put() on it when not need anymore. Add missing of_node_put() to avoid refcount leak. In brcmstb_init_sram, it pass dn to of_address_to_resource(), of_address_to_resource() will call of_find_device_by_node() to take reference, so we should release the reference returned by of_find_matching_node().

The advisory is available at git.kernel.org. This vulnerability is handled as CVE-2022-49678 since 02/26/2025. Technical details are known, but there is no available exploit.

Upgrading to version 4.19.250, 5.4.202, 5.10.127, 5.15.51 or 5.18.8 eliminates this vulnerability. Applying the patch 4f5877bdf7b593e988f1924f4c3df6523f80b39c/734a4d15142bb4c8ecad2d8ec70d7564e78ae34d/30bbfeb480ae8b5ee43199d72417b232590440c2/10ba9d499a9fd82ed40897e734ba19870a879407/dcafd5463d8f20c4f90ddc138a5738adb99f74c8/37d838de369b07b596c19ff3662bf0293fdb09ee is able to eliminate this problem. The bugfix is ready for download at git.kernel.org. The best possible mitigation is suggested to be upgrading to the latest version.
